Title: Training Your Dog To
Heel
Author: Anthony Stai
Article:
One of the first commands your dog learns ought to
be the 'HEEL' command. This command will be useful in insuring the
security of your dog while out in public and will make you look
like the proprietor of a well-mannered and lovable dog. To
add to the magnificence of all this, the command itself is
rather easy and almost any dog can be taught the meaning of the
command with 30 minutes or so of effort.
So what is the function of the 'heel' command? This
one word command tells your dog that the animal is to saunter
in a straight line at your side, not earlier than or
following you. This provides security for your dog in public places
as well as for yourself. The command keeps your dog at your
side rather than running throughout the picnic blankets of
recreational area goers and, if you possess a larger more menacing
breed, makes you appear a less friendly target to would-be
criminal elements.
Wow, that sounds great' How do I educate my dog?
Well, it isn't as tricky as you might believe. There are two
all-purpose methods of training. One uses merely positive
reinforcement and the other uses a combination of both positive and
negative strategy. First we will discuss the positive
reinforcement method.
In this technique, you have to first put your dog on
a short leash and acquire quite a few of the dogs preferred
foodstuff treats, little pieces of dried out kibble from the
animals dog food is normally appropriate. Decide which side you
have a preference your dog to walk on and train from this
side in the subsequent manner. With the dog by your side, in
front of in the same direction, put a treat in your hand
subsequently to your hip. In a hard, yet kind voice, say 'heel' and walk
onward. When the dog responds by stepping with you, commend them
and reward them with the treat. Remember to be consistent and
not to reward prior to the feat is carried out, yet at all times
reward for a good performance. With a lot of patience, this
technique will work fine for most dogs and results in a close
bonding of the dog to the owner. However, some dogs are just
naturally harder to train, just like some people. If you are blessed
with one of these independent and physically powerful willed
pets then you might have to avail yourself of a different
technique of training, which was mentioned previous in this
discussion.
To use the second training technique, you have to
start with a somewhat longer leash of approximately seven to ten
feet. Allow your dog a little moments to travel around the
boundaries of the leash and understand how it works. Then call the
animal to your side and position manually as before with the animal
next to you, facing the same direction. In a hard voice, say
'heel' and walk onward. At this time, the dog will most likely
not walk with you. It will, in its place, begin to travel
around most probable running in a different direction than
wherever you are leading. To fix this behaviour, revolve in the
opposite direction of the pets' direction of travel and take a few
steps onward, fairly briskly, as you hoist the leash to shoulder
height and let it play out after you. The outcome of this act
will be seen as the animal rapidly reaches the finish of the
leash and their onward impetus teaches them the era aged physics
lesson that 'Every deed has an equivalent and opposite
reaction.' The animal will fairly rapidly learn that to refuse to comply
the heel command results in a discomforting feeling from the
abrupt stop at the end of the leash and, after a short while,
will be taught to abide by the command. When the dog reaches the
condition of obedience, be certain to reward them with lots of
positive reinforcements, such as play time and treats, along
with rich spoken praise.
Whichever of these methods you choose in the
training of your dog, the 'heel' command is certain to go a long way
in making you a greatly more contented dog owner who will be
proud to demonstrate your dog anyplace. Remember to train
with love, patience and consistency and your dog will return
you with devotion and many, many years of companionship.
